The Loft, located at 1374 W Peachtree St NW, Atlanta, GA 30309, is a premier live music venue that has been entertaining audiences for years. With a rich history of hosting some of the biggest names in music, The Loft continues to be a staple in the Atlanta entertainment scene.

Upon entering The Loft, guests are immediately greeted by the warm and inviting atmosphere. The venue features a large stage, state-of-the-art sound and lighting systems, and plenty of seating for patrons to enjoy the show. With a full bar and restaurant on-site, guests can indulge in delicious food and beverages while taking in the live performances.

The Loft is committed to providing an accessible and inclusive experience for all guests. The venue offers wheelchair accessible entrance, parking, and restrooms, ensuring that everyone can enjoy the music and entertainment.

With a diverse lineup of artists and bands, The Loft caters to a wide range of musical tastes. From rock and roll to hip-hop and everything in between, there's always something for everyone at this iconic Atlanta venue.

It was an interesting space to see a show. They have a massive back room where you can sit and chill for a bit, and a side room with couches. Two bars! However, the standing room is tiny… and the stage is tiny. It is hardly lifted, so you can’t really see the artist if you are in the back. People really cram and push in this tight space. If you are short, like me, you won’t have a good time unless you are at the front of the stage, and don’t even think about leaving to use the bathroom. The sound was okay, wasn’t the best. The ceiling looked like it needed to be sprayed down. I could see foam falling from the ceiling.

If you aren't an avid concert goer, probably best for you to skip this venue. Most concerts are going to be standing room only. Doors open an hour before showtime and unless you're into the opener. You'll be standing in your spot for two hours if you want a chance to see the bottom half of any performer.

Noise - the venue is tight enough / has a tucked in seating area so people talking and chatting was about as loud as the artist.

View - this is a "be tall or be early and ready to wait" venue. The stage is small and not centered with the room. It's also only a couple of feet off the ground and not graded so either you get close to the front or you'll need to find a window between heads

Security - there was an effort at the door but overserved patrons should be shown the door after infraction number three. It's too small of a place not to harsh everybody else's vibe.
